About 5,5-dimethylthieno[3,2-b]pyran 1-oxide
5,5-dimethylthieno[3,2-b]pyran 1-oxide (PubChem CID 67836000) has the molecular formula C9H10O2S
and a molecular weight of 182.24 g/mol. Its IUPAC name is 5,5-dimethylthieno[3,2-b]pyran 1-oxide.
